What type of Heatsink/Fan are you using? Also, what kind of Thermal Compound are you using?

If you are using Arctic Silver as your thermal compound make sure that you don't have too much on. You don't want to put as much as the AS website instructs shows... instead you want a "translucent haze" on your CPU die. I went from AS instructs to "translucent haze" and dropped 5C!
